A group home for someone who has been involved in drug abuse is a facility which offers continuous support and help for folks in recovery. A group home is usually for troubled youth, but additionally, there are group homes for those with a mental health disorder or who are encountering behavioral difficulties for example. Instead of sending individuals who are experiencing substance abuse or recovering from drug abuse to an orphanage, asylum and other similar place, a group home can help provide an appropriate environment to help maintain stability within their lives and also have counsel and support within reach 24/7. People who reside in the group home could be taking part in treatment services whilst in residence, or could possibly be taking measures to get their life setup outside the group home to enable them to at some time live independently away from the group home. For instance, a troubled youth who may have been in recovery or has recovered from substance abuse can work on getting their GED or acquire work. A group home is definitely not a long-term or permanent solution, yet it's a feasible short-term option for many who are attempting to get their lives back together again.
